How to Add a Zoom Meeting Link to an Outlook Calendar Event

You need to schedule a meeting in Outlook and include a Zoom link for participants. Outlook does not have a built-in Zoom button, but you can add the link manually or use an add-in. This article explains the steps to insert a Zoom meeting URL into any calendar event.

Methods for Adding a Zoom Link to an Event

You can connect a Zoom meeting to an Outlook calendar event in two main ways. The manual method works for any web conferencing link. The automated method uses the official Zoom for Outlook add-in, which must be installed first. Both methods ensure your invitees have the correct link to join the virtual meeting.

Manual Method: Copy and Paste the Link

Use this method if you already have a Zoom meeting link from the Zoom web portal or desktop app. You simply copy the invitation details and paste them into the Outlook event.

Steps to Manually Insert a Zoom Link

  1. Create a new calendar event
    Open your Outlook calendar. Click New Event or double-click a time slot.
  2. Add the Zoom link to the Location field
    Click in the Location field. Paste the full Zoom meeting URL, such as https://zoom.us/j/123456789. This makes the link visible on the calendar grid.
  3. Paste full details in the body
    In the large description area, paste the entire Zoom invitation text. Include the meeting ID, passcode, and dial-in numbers.
  4. Send the invitation
    Add your attendees and click Send. The link in the Location field will be clickable for all recipients.

Automated Method: Use the Zoom Add-in

The Zoom for Outlook add-in creates a new Zoom meeting directly from Outlook. It inserts the link, meeting ID, and dial-in details automatically. You must install the add-in from the Microsoft AppSource store or your organization’s admin.

Steps to Use the Zoom for Outlook Add-in

  1. Install the add-in
    In Outlook, go to Home > Get Add-ins. Search for “Zoom” and click Add next to Zoom for Outlook. Follow the prompts to install it.
  2. Create a new meeting
    Open a new calendar event. A Zoom button should appear in the ribbon on the Meeting tab.
  3. Generate the Zoom meeting
    Click the Zoom button. A dialog will appear. Click Schedule a Meeting. The add-in will create a new Zoom meeting and populate the event body with the link and details.
  4. Review and send
    Check the event details. The Location field and body will contain the Zoom information. Add attendees and send the invitation.

Common Mistakes and Limitations

These are typical errors users make when adding Zoom links to Outlook.

The Zoom Button Is Missing in Outlook

If the Zoom button does not appear, the add-in is not installed or is disabled. Go to File > Manage Add-ins in Outlook online to check its status. Some organizations block add-in installation, requiring admin approval.

Recipients Cannot Click the Link

Outlook may treat a pasted URL as plain text. To fix this, after pasting, select the link text and press Ctrl+K to insert a hyperlink. Ensure the address in the dialog is correct and click OK.

Meeting Details Are Incomplete

The add-in may not insert the passcode. Always review the auto-generated text. Manually add the passcode if it is missing, as this is required for many meetings.

Manual vs. Add-in Method Comparison

Item Manual Method Zoom Add-in Method
Setup Required None Must install add-in
Speed Fast for existing links Fast for creating new meetings
Automation No automation Auto-generates link and details
Reliability High, depends on copied link High, direct from Zoom service
Best For Recurring or pre-made meetings One-off new meetings
